Before Shuji Ishikawa faces Isami Kodaka for the Union MAX Title, he takes Seiya Morohashi. Despite being a mainstay of Union, Morohashi was not part of the original group that jumped from DDT when the brand formed back in 2005. Morohashi instead joined a few years later. Ishikawa is proud of Morohashi’s time in Union. He brought up one time when he fell ill and had to pull out of a match. Morohashi took his place at the last minute and gave a physically intense performance. I bet the match he is talking about is Morohashi Vs Shigehiro Irie from July 2012. Ishikawa wants to thank Morohashi for always being there for Union.

It must have been a confusing weekend for KANNA. She got a bump in Twitter followers when the other Kana appeared on screen at NXT TakeOver. WWE spelt Kana’s name with two ‘N’s leading some thirsty fans to KANNA’s Twitter account by mistake.

Miyu Yamashita had her debut shoot boxing bout on 21st August at the “GIRLS S-CUP 2015” event in Tokyo. She fought Yurika GSB in the 54kg weight class. Unfortunately Yamashita lost the fight by unanimous decision after three rounds. Yamashita said she felt embarrassed by the defeat because she carried the weight of Tokyo Joshi Pro on her shoulders and let everybody down. However she would like to get another fight and will train more in shoot boxing for the time being.

DDT “KING OF DDT 2015 OSAKA”, 14/06/2015
Osaka Prefectural Gymnasium #2
1,042 Fans – Super No Vacancy

0. King Of Dark Title: Suguru Miyatake (c) & Kota Umeda defeated Gota Ihashi & Hiroshi Fukuda when Miyatake pinned Ihashi with the Heart Attack (6:45).
*Suguru Miyatake passes D2. Gota Ihashi becomes the 3rd King Of Dark Champion.
1. HARASHIMA, Akiro, Yasu Urano, Tomomitsu Matsunaga & Saki Akai defeated Sanshiro Takagi, Toru Owashi, Kazuki Hirata, Devin Sparks & Ric Ellis when HARASHIMA pinned Hirata with the Somato (10:28).
2. 4 Way Match: KUDO defeated Danshoku Dino, Keisuke Ishii and Antonio Honda when KUDO pinned Honda with the Diving Double Knee Drop (8:49).
3. King Of DDT 2015 – Round 2: Yukio Sakaguchi defeated Makoto Oishi with the Right Knee Of God (7:19).
4. King Of DDT 2015 – Round 2: Konosuke Takeshita defeated Masa Takanashi with the German Suplex (9:47).
5. KO-D Tag Team Titles: Daisuke Sekimoto & Yuji Okabayashi (c) defeated MIKAMI & Shuji Ishikawa when Okabayashi pinned MIKAMI with the Golem Splash (19:29).
*V4 for Strong BJ.
6. King Of DDT 2015 – Round 2: Daisuke Sasaki defeated Kota Ibushi with the Sasaki Huracanrana (18:48).
7. King Of DDT 2015 – Round 2: Kazusada Higuchi defeated Shigehiro Irie with the Goten (18:23).

The King Of DDT semi-finals are set. Kazusada Higuchi Vs Yukio Sakaguchi and Konosuke Takeshita Vs Daisuke Sasaki will take place on 28th June along with the grand final. Sakaguchi dispatched Makoto Oishi with the Right Knee Of God. Takeshita narrowly avoided being wrongly disqualified when Masa Takanashi faked getting hit with the DDT Extreme Title belt he stole from Akito again after Match #1. Sasaki got the upset win over his stablemate Kota Ibushi. Sasaki seated Ibushi on a chair outside the ring and did a Super Diving Elbow Drop from the top rope onto him. Sasaki avoided the Sit Down Last Ride and pulled in the ref to distract Ibushi and flash pin him with the Sasaki Huracanrana. Ibushi was disappointed to lose and blamed Suguru Miyatake. Finally in the battle of the heavyweights Higuchi scored a great victory over Shigehiro Irie. Higuchi offered a handshake after the match but Irie rejected it.

DDT will move up from Osaka Prefectural Gymnasium #2 to the bigger Osaka Prefectural Gymnasium #1 on 28th November. The event is called “OSAKA OCTOPUS 2015” and the main event will be the KO-D Openweight Champion defending the title against the winner of this year’s DDT Dramatic General Election. Sanshiro Takagi spoke about the building hosting matches like Nobuhiko Takada Vs Bob Backlund as well as cards from UWF and SWS.

Despite being thrown off by MIKAMI’s speed and use of ladders, Strong BJ succeeded in another KO-D Tag Team Titles defence. Yuji Okabayashi is confident he and Daisuke Sekimoto can beat anyone in DDT. Right now there are no immediate challengers in line.

Ken Ohka appeared in the balcony after the 4 Way Match to give another warning to KUDO about cashing in his Right To Challenge contract. Amon Tsurumi apologised to KUDO for allowing Ohka to sneak into the show again. KUDO didn’t care because he knows Ohka is not going to cash in anytime soon.

Hello darkness my old friend. Gota Ihashi is now a two time King Of Dark Champion. He never got a chance to enjoy wrestling outside of the preshow. Amon Tsurumi happily handed Ihashi the belt after the match.

DDT “OSAKA BAY BLUES SPECIAL 2012”, 16/09/2012
Osaka Prefectural Gymnasium #2
1,007 Fans – Super No Vacancy

1. Mio Shirai, Hideki Shiota & Kiai Ryuuken Ecchan defeated Makoto Oishi, Hiroshi Fukuda & DJ Nira when Shirai pinned Fukuda with the Purple Flash (4:06).
2. Yukio Sakaguchi defeated Michael Nakazawa with the Venom Choke (7:12).
3. Hikaru Sato & Shoichi Uchida defeated Akito & Tetsuya Endo when Uchida pinned Endo with the Diving Headbutt (10:20).
4. Iron Man Heavymetalweight Title: Yoshiaki Fujiwara (c) defeated Danshoku Dino with a Side Armbar (7:30).
*V1 for Yoshiaki Fujiwara?
5. HUB defeated Daisuke Sasaki with the Deadly Poison Airstrike (13:31).
6. Sanshiro Takagi & Yuji Hino defeated Kota Ibushi & Konosuke Takeshita when Takagi pinned Takeshita with the Sit Down Himawari Bomb (18:16).
7. KO-D Tag Team Title: MIKAMI & Tatsumi Fujinami (c) defeated Yasu Urano & Antonio Honda when Fujinami submitted Honda with a Rear Naked Choke (11:08).
*V1 for MIKAMI & Tatsumi Fujinami.
8. DDT Vs Drift Series: Keisuke Ishii, Takao Soma & Shigehiro Irie defeated HARASHIMA, KUDO & Masa Takanashi.
8a. HARASHIMA Vs Shigehiro Irie ended in a Time Limit Draw (10:00).
8b. Takao Soma defeated Masa Takanashi with the Boma Ye (1:24).
8c. KUDO defeated Takao Soma with the Buzzsaw Kick (3:40).
8d. KUDO Vs Keisuke Ishii ended in a Time Limit Draw (10:00).
8e. Sudden Death: Keisuke Ishii defeated KUDO with the Kneel Kick (3:29).

The DDT Vs Drift series was a Gauntlet match with each bout lasting ten minutes. For time limit draws both wrestlers were eliminated from the match, as shown with HARASHIMA and Shigehiro Irie. The final match between KUDO and Keisuke Ishii ended the same way but since the series ended 1-1 they decided to have sudden death. Ishii was able to get the best of KUDO and win the series for Team Dream Futures.

MIKAMI & Tatsumi Fujinami will next defend the KO-D Tag Team Titles in Sapporo on 8th October. Their opponents might be Sanshiro Takagi and a mystery masked man from Okinawa. Another idea is for them to be accompanied by Shogun KY Wakamatsu. There’s a blast from the past for you.

HUB was very aggressive in his match against Daisuke Sasaki. While attacking Sasaki, HUB could be overheard telling Sasaki “I wanted to go to Bolivia too!”

Yoshiaki Fujiwara defeated Danshoku Dino by giving him an unexpected kiss, which surprised and distracted Dino long enough to get him pinned.
